The Vitra Butterfly Stool, designed by Sori Yanagi, showcases innovative plywood shaping inspired by mid-century modernists. It features two interlocking elements forming a mirrored, sculptural silhouette. Crafted from bent plywood, finished in rich palisander or light maple, it echoes organic Japanese design. The form is supported by a brass bar within the base, and secured with discreet screws under the seat, offering a harmonious blend of aesthetics and stability.

Original Product Description:

Designed by Sori Yanagi, the Butterfly develops contemporary techniques of shaping plywood first pioneered by mid-century designers Charles & Ray Eames.This sculptural stool is made of two simple elements that mirror each other's shape to create a unique platform.Made from bent plywood that is lacquered in either light maple or rich palisander, the Butterfly has been formed into a unique series of swoops and flicks that hint towards the organic style of Japanese design.To ensure a solid structure, a supporting brass bar is fitted inside the base while two small screws underneath the seat keep the top locked tightly together.
